
American tycoon Amazon founder Jeff Bezos admits he is always late for meetings with his staff, except for one.
“The only meeting I’m ever on time for is my first meeting (of the day), because I won’t finish a meeting until I’m really finished,” said Bezos at the recent New York Times DealBook Summit, the India Times reported.
As his meetings are characterized by meandering topics and he encourages everyone to speak their mind, the protracted discussions have caused Bezos to be late for his next meeting.
Meanwhile, in England, street pay parking machines require parkers to pay the fee strictly within five minutes. Later than that means being charged a late fee.
Rosey Hudson parks her car daily on Copeland Street in Derby, paying the £3.30 fee each day. In February 2023, the parking machine was out of order, so she tried to pay the fee online through a phone app.
Due to a poor signal at the site, however, Hudson always went to the nearby Derbion Center to connect to WiFi and pay online.
Recently, Hudson received a parking charge notice (PCN) from Excel Parking saying she had exceeded the maximum period of five minutes to purchase the tariff at Copeland Street and told her to pay £100 within 28 days, or £60 if she paid within a fortnight, the Independent reported.
She called Excel Parking to explain that the parking machine was broken but they insisted that she pay the fee. After paying the fee, Hudson received nine more PCNs each charging her £100 and other fees for taking between 14 to 190 minutes to pay the tariff, according to the Independent.
A mediation on the payment dispute failed so the case of Hudson and Excel Parking will be decided by a court in the next six months.
